Java生成 Code128C 格式 条形码

求问java中如何实现生成Code128C条形码,或者有什么工具包可以使用?

0

2个回答

0

Free Spire.Barcode for Java

 import java.awt.image.BufferedImage;
import java.io.File;
import java.io.IOException;

import javax.imageio.ImageIO;

import com.spire.barcode.BarCodeGenerator;
import com.spire.barcode.BarCodeType;
import com.spire.barcode.BarcodeSettings;

public class CODE_128 {

    public static void main(String[] args) throws IOException {

        //创建BarcodeSettings实例
        BarcodeSettings settings = new BarcodeSettings();
        //设置条形码类型
        settings.setType(BarCodeType.CODE_128);       
        //设置条形码数据
        settings.setData("123456789");
        //设置条形码显示数据
        settings.setData2D("123456789");     
        //在底部显示数据
        settings.setShowTextOnBottom(true);
        //设置边框为不可见
        settings.hasBorder(false);
        //创建BarCodeGenerator实例
        BarCodeGenerator barCodeGenerator = new BarCodeGenerator(settings);
        //根据settings生成图像数据,保存至BufferedImage实例
        BufferedImage bufferedImage = barCodeGenerator.generateImage();
        //保存为PNG图片
        ImageIO.write(bufferedImage, "png", new File("CODE128.png"));
        System.out.println("Complete!");
    }
}
0
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
其他相关推荐
Java 生成Code128C编码条形码
Java 原生库生成Code128C编码的条形码的工具类,根据http://blog.csdn.net/susu_139/article/details/41008433整理而成
code128C条码Java算法--生成顺丰单号条形码
package com.iskyinfo.shinytel.test; import java.awt.Color; import java.awt.Graphics; import java.awt.image.BufferedImage; import java.io.File; import java.io.FileOutputStream; import java.io
C#以图形方式输出Code128C条形码
图形方式输出Code128C条形码最近的项目牵涉到一维条码打印的问题。条码的选型上倒没什么,因为要求短且仅包含数字,所以决定选用Code128C。在国外的网站上找了点资料研究了下,终于大致搞懂了Code128C的原理和实现方法。Code128C只能编码长度是偶数的数字串,这是它的前提之一。说起来编码规则很简单,00 - 99 这100个数字每个数字都预先规定好一个条码,然后把原始的待编码字
php生成code128条形码
注:请用这个方法可控制条形码和路径:https://blog.csdn.net/qq_27229113/article/details/82856386 php生成code128条形码 效果图:   <?php class BarCode128 {     const STARTA = 103;     const STARTB = 104;     const STARTC = 1...
条码CODE128C语言算法
C语言 实现的一维码CODE128编码算法
生成Code128C码的单色位图文件
生成Code128C码的单色位图文件 还是在以前公司做的一个项目中的一个小功能。使用喷码机进行可变条二维条码的喷码,二维码不是通用的QR码,客户数据采集很麻烦,定制修改的PDA读码成功率很低,所以生成一个与二位码相对应的一维码,喷码时喷码二维码的下面,供客户在进行物流数据采集时使用一维条码枪进行数据读取,这样的条码我们自己称为双码标签(二维码用于防伪时读取,一维码用于物流数据的采集,这两个...
水晶报表条形码code128
水晶报表条形码code128
Java生成条形码code128
生成code 128条形码工具类 maven依赖 <!-- https://mvnrepository.com/artifact/net.sf.barcode4j/barcode4j --> <dependency> <groupId>net.sf.barcode4j</groupId> <artifactId>ba...
字符串生成条码(CODE128),并实现条码打印!
最近的项目有一个条码打印的要求, 鉴于很多条码软件/库 都是收费的, 一直在找免费的. 在Google上搜了很久, 资料是不少, 但不是免费的 就是 没有源码的. 于是, 决定自己写代码解决. 继续Google, 看了下CODE128的原理, 貌似挺复杂, 还分3个字符集, 比较下来 决定使用CODESET B. 先简述一下CODE128的原理吧,分别以一个unic...
java code128a、b、c
网上有java生成条形 码的各种方式,有code128的生成,但是没有code128A、B、C对应的生成方式,这里有A的生成代码,B、C的代码没写完,但是看代码注释就能写好。直接可以的代码,写的web小项目,可以部署直接使用的,提前设置默认打印可直接使用的代码
C#生成Code128条形码
C生成Code128条形码 Code128码简介 C程序的编写 1添加Code128码类 2在Cfrom窗体中生成按钮Click事件 结论C#生成Code128条形码Code128码简介Code128码于1981年推出,是一种长度可变、连续性的字母数字条码。与其他一维条码比较起来,相对较为复杂,支持的字元也相对较多,又有不同的编码方式可供交互运用,因此其应用弹性也较大。Code128特性: 1、具
JAVA生成Code128条形码,用于申通快递单单号
package com.wl.cn.business.express.util; import java.awt.image.BufferedImage; import java.io.ByteArrayOutputStream; import org.jbarcode.JBarcode; import org.jbarcode.encode.Code128Encoder; im
一维条形码CODE128编码及字符集CODE A、B、C解析
在进行一维条形码打印的编程中知道了条形码有一种类型是code128,也是比较常用的,具体的字符集有3种,分别为A、B、C,这三种的说明如下: A格式:数字、大写字母和控制字符组成的字符串,如ABC、ABC123 B格式:数字、大小写字母和字符组成的字符串,如Abc123、a-123(B) C格式:双位数字组成的字符串,如1234、00008182。 一般来说,如果条幅内容是大写英文字母,用
水晶报表中用Code128制作条型码的方法
一、在【文件系统】中新建一个【Fonts文件夹】,然后添加【Code128.ttf】文件。 二、在水晶报表里的【字段资源管理器】的【公式字段】中新建一个公式字段。点击【使用编辑器】之后弹出【公式工作室】。 三、在【公式工作室】中的【报表自定义函数】新建一个函数,在代码框中输入如下代码(VB代码): Function fncGetCd128SetB ( strIn As string ) As
自绘条形码(code39 + code128A+C奇偶数)
前言:如果你看了我之前的blog,你就知道我在公司里面主要负责的还是pdf的编写。然后本来觉得该改进的东西也就没什么问题了,做的都挺完善的,但是还是炸锅了。 因为原来打印出来都挺perfect的,直到项目部署到一个子公司那里。他们用的打印机是针式打印机(不知道是什么的同学自行百度一下,就是我小学的时候家里的那种打印机。。。我小学大概2005年左右?),然后这种打印机,虽然旧了点,什么都还ok,唯独
java用JBarcode组件生成条形码(支持自定义字体及颜色),图文详解之2-1
前言: JBarcode入门教程我就不写了,可以参考:点击打开链接 我的这篇教程和上篇博客的不同之处: 1 上篇博客直接生成二维码图片放到d盘的某个文件夹下,我的二维码生成二维码后直接用Base64编码然后返回到前台页面。 2 上篇博客只介绍了生成商品条形码,其他二维如Code93码、ISBN码、ISSN码、Code128码等等都没有介绍。我的博客里会介绍这些条码怎么生成。我文末会介绍常用
android编程实现128条形码的生成和识别
CODE128
CODE 128 条码生成方法
Code 128 Barcode Table Value Code Set A Code Set B Code Set C Bar/Space Pattern B S B S B S 0 SP SP 00 2 1 2 2 2 2 1 ! ! 01 2 2 2 1 2 2 2 " "
Java如何生成Code128C条形码
Java 生成Code128C条形码。 Code128C条形码 Code128条形码 短条形码
VB编写的Code128码转换实例
用VB编写的Code128码转换实例: 可转换Code128A、Code128B、Code128C; 也可自动识别最优Code128Auto 代码可封装成DLL
一维条形码 code128 的全面介绍
0:code128,编码格式: Code128A字符集 包括大写字母、数字、常用标点符号和一些控制符。 Code128B字符集 包括大小写字母、数字、常用标点符号。 Code128C字符集 为纯数字序列。 Code128Auto 是将上述三种字符集最佳优化组合。 1:Code128编码规则:开始位 + [FNC1(为EAN128码时加)] + 数据位 
java用JBarcode组件生成条形码(支持自定义字体及颜色)
前言: JBarcode入门教程我就不写了,可以参考:点击打开链接 我的这篇教程和上篇博客的不同之处: 1 上篇博客直接生成二维码图片放到d盘的某个文件夹下,我的二维码生成二维码后直接用Base64编码然后返回到前台页面。 2 上篇博客只介绍了生成商品条形码,其他二维如Code93码、ISBN码、ISSN码、Code128码等等都没有介绍。我的博客里会介绍这些条码怎么生成。我文末会介绍常用条码及其如
opencv 条形码识别
基于opencv实现的图像中条形码识别,可以更换自己的图像测试效果
code128b条码生成程序
 FUNCTION get_char(char_code IN PLS_INTEGER) RETURN VARCHAR2 IS     LANGUAGE JAVA NAME 'xxfnd.XxfndBarcodeUtil.getChar(int) return String'; FUNCTION code128b(data_to_encode IN VARCHAR2) R
C#条形码生成(三)----简单的三种Code128实现
编写这三类条形码的时候,网上baidu来baidu去,就是没找到关于Code128A,Code128B,Code128C的明确定义,然后就按照网上通用的说法只取相应的字符集来编写了这部分代码 CodeA public class Code128A : absCode128 { /// /// Code128A条形码,只支持128字符集A(数字、大
Code128 条码生成
// // ================================================= //   条码打印 //    //    设计: 陈炎和 2011.03 //================================================== // //BarCode128有三种不同的版本:A(数字、大写字母、控制字符)B(数字、
CODE128码生成源码
打开字体生成Code128、Ean128条码.xls文件,使用生成条形码前提: 复制code 128.ttf文件到系统盘\WINDOWS\Fonts文件夹中 如系统盘符为C:\,则将code 128.ttf文件复制到C:\WINDOWS\Fonts文件夹中
C#把数字转化成条形码
其实Windows本身就有一个字体是用来显示条形码的。 只要将数字改为这种字体就变成了条形码。 windows字体库下,有如下八种字体可以用来将数字转换成条形码: Code39AzaleaNarrow1 Code39AzaleaNarrow2 Code39AzaleaNarrow3 Code39AzaleaRegular1 Code39AzaleaRegular2 Code39
office excel批量生成code128条形码
excel 批量生成条形码
教你看懂Code128条形码
http://www.tiaoma100.com/doc/3852 Code128码分成三类,即128A、128B、128C。它们的区别就是对应的字符表不一样。 那么Code128码到底怎么读呢?请看下面的图: 从左往右是黑白相间的条形码,黑的叫“条”(B),白的叫“空”(S)。 如果你仔细看,条和空都有4种不同的宽度。我们将它从细到粗赋予1、2、3、4这几个值。 然后我们开
java打印条形码Code128C
  生成编码类型为Code128C的条形码的javaCODE: package test; import java.awt.Color; import java.awt.Graphics; import java.awt.image.BufferedImage; import java.io.File; import java.io.FileOutputStream; import java.i...
生成条形码并打印(code128ABC)
MFC基于对话框,生成条形码,支持code128
Delphi生成条码(EAN13/128)单元源码
D7和XE5下编译测试过. 单元源码为生成条码, 返回Image,TBitmat等, 可以根据自己的需求扩展其它功能
基于ASP.NET生成条形码(code128)
using System; using System.Collections.Generic; using System.Linq; using System.Web; using System.Drawing; using System.Data; namespace MvcGuestBook.Common { //条形码公共类 public class BarCode128
barcode4j 条形码使用
用java生成条形码,barcode4j得应用    1.去http://barcode4j.sourceforge.net/下载文件,(源代码和生成好的都要下载)     2.解压barcode4j-2.0alpha2-bin.zip这个包,在build目录下有barcode4j.jar,在lib目录下有avalon-framework-4.2.0.jar, 将barcode4j.jar和a
条码(code128)的不同版本实现
好久没写Blog了,这次写写条码(code128)打印的实现。条码在工业应用方面很广泛,所以我们在编写程序时,特别是打印报表时,经常用到。#region "本段为转载"  转自:http://kaliking.blog.51cto.com/58641/33734先简述一下CODE128的原理吧,分别以一个unicode字符作为起始符(Ì)和终止符(Î),然后需要根据你的字符串, 计
java生成39条形码base64数据
maven项目首先要导入pom资源 <dependency> <groupId>net.sf.barcode4j</groupId> <artifactId>barcode4j-light</artifactId> <version>2.0</version> </dependency>
ZXing实现条形码、二维码
一、 基本介绍          1-1. ZXing是一个开源Java类库用于解析多种格式的条形码和二维码。官网:http://code.google.com/p/zxing/          截止目前为止最新版本为1.7,提供以下编码格式的支持: UPC-A and UPC-EEAN-8 and EAN-13Code 39Code 93Code 128QR CodeITFC
java使用jbarcode生成条形码
准备工作: 开发工具:eclipse4.5+jdk1.7 所需jar包:jbarcode-0.2.8.jar 案例: package jbarcode; import java.awt.Color; import java.awt.Font; import java.awt.FontMetrics; import java.awt.Graphics; import java.awt.im
Freemaker 模板生成html文件带barcode4j条形码并转PDF
前面野了三篇博客,现在直接结合在一起做一个实例首先生成条形码并且放入html转换成pdf下载下来,将所有功能集合在一起 1.条形码String barcode=BarCodeUtil.create39Code(“A123456”);实现方法public static String create39Code(String code) { ByteArrayOutputStream b
文章热词 机器学习教程 Objective-C培训 交互设计视频教程 颜色模型 设计制作学习
相关热词 mysql关联查询两次本表 native底部 react extjs glyph 图标 java数字格式学习 java 生成班级编号